First improvements toward a reproducible Telemac-2D

Rafife Nheili 1 Philippe Langlois 1 Christophe Denis 2
1 DALI - Digits, Architectures et Logiciels Informatiques
LIRMM - Laboratoire d'Informatique de Robotique et de Microélectronique de Montpellier, UPVD - Université de Perpignan Via Domitia
Abstract : OpenTelemac suffers from numerical reproducibil-ity failures. In parallel simulations, the domain distribution toward units computing with floating-point arithmetic may yield different numerical results. Numerical reproducibility is a requested feature to facilitate the debug, the validation and the test of industrial or large codes. We present how to apply compensation techniques to recover reproducibility in the finite element computation of a hydrodynamics simulation. Compensation is used in both the building and the resolution phases of the linear system which are not reproducible in the current version of the software. Here the building step relies on the element-by-element storage mode and the solving step applies the conjugated gradient algorithm. We also measure that the running time extra-cost of the reproducible version is reasonable enough in practice.
Type de document :
Communication dans un congrès
XXIIIrd TELEMAC-MASCARET User Conference , Oct 2016, Paris, France. <http://www.opentelemac.org/index.php/user-conference26>
Liste complète des métadonnées


https://hal-lirmm.ccsd.cnrs.fr/lirmm-01371152
Contributeur : Rafife Nheili <>
Soumis le : samedi 24 septembre 2016 - 10:51:59
Dernière modification le : vendredi 9 juin 2017 - 10:43:02

Fichier

TUC_2016_NHEILI.pdf
Fichiers produits par l'(les) auteur(s)

Identifiants

  • HAL Id : lirmm-01371152, version 1

Citation

Rafife Nheili, Philippe Langlois, Christophe Denis. First improvements toward a reproducible Telemac-2D. XXIIIrd TELEMAC-MASCARET User Conference , Oct 2016, Paris, France. <http://www.opentelemac.org/index.php/user-conference26>. <lirmm-01371152>

Partager

Métriques

Consultations de
la notice

60

Téléchargements du document

88